Output 81884b63cbd7a2c7a56bb1026f8b4cd4de2c954cdfb93c8b1179c97ef773b7d0:2

value
345171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8122400944e37fd88ac8f46f764b85cecec05eb2 OP_EQUAL
address
3DTp82mxxfx2YUXfiNrV63RD2ZfB9ECbba
transaction
81884b63cbd7a2c7a56bb1026f8b4cd4de2c954cdfb93c8b1179c97ef773b7d0
spent
true